Types of Liqueurs to Expect

Local Liqueur Selection

Typically, you will be in a position to test flavors such as grappa and herbal infused drinks. Maraschino is quite popular. What’s more, it shows the use of indigenous ingredients. If you are guided in trying the liqueurs, as you almost certainly will be, this may bring in details on making them. Very often, some producers love talking to anyone keen to learn the inside secrets behind, in what way, these old-style recipes are kept alive.

Typical Dishes Served

Traditional Croatian Dishes

Very commonly, barbecued fish features highly on the menu. You get a flavor from the sea, and often with recipes that have evolved down the ages. It also shows a devotion to, very, very simple yet fulfilling cooking. Platters of regional cheese and smoked ham show more local foods that the area is famous for.

Don’t be too surprised if you get a helping of Peka. It, you see, usually has meat and vegetables cooked together under a bell shaped lid. This, arguably, demonstrates regional cooking skills and methods at its very finest. All in all, the dining provides the tastes to give your trip an insight, you know, from end to end.
